Great BBQ! Brisket was fantastic… lots of flavor, super tender. Ribs had great flavor, basic rub of salt & pepper, but pretty tough. Needed more time in the cooler. Mac was awesome, beans were a bit underdone and tough. Burnt ends were amazing and sausage had great flavor and snap. Star of the night was the Butchers Popcorn, deep fried pork jowl… like little meat angels dancing across my tongue and melting in my mouth. They need this at theaters…

It’s not bad barbecue but its low on the smoked flavour compared to other BBQ joints in the city and in a day and age where peanut allergies are widespread, they unfortunately cook with peanut oil which means all the food(and I mean all, as I asked about what oil they use to cook and was told the peanut oil they cook the chicken in gets into all the food due to splatter) is contaminated with it, so this place is a no go zone for those with nut allergies.

I was pretty excited when I found out that Southern Smoke was setting up on Ottawa St N. Great addition to the restaurants that are already there. Food was priced reasonably and tasted fantastic. They even had a vegetarian option that they call The Lazy Hunter. It’s basically a giant, delicious portobello mushroom sandwich with a garlic sauce that was to die for. The brisket was tender and full of flavour. There’s a weekend breakfast menu and a kids menu too. The atmosphere was fun and casual. They did a great job renoing the old deli. The only thing that need work is their side fries. They tasted pretty good but man were they ever mushy. I’ll give them a 5 star rating even with the mushy fries.
